Understanding FDA 483 Trends and Their Implications

The FDA’s Form 483 is a crucial tool used by inspectors to document observations made during inspections of regulated entities. Often leading to warning letters, these observations indicate significant compliance violations. The patterns observed in FDA 483 trends, especially those pertaining to data integrity, can serve as indicators of systemic issues within an organization. Understanding these trends is the first step in designing effective executive dashboards.

Data integrity pertains to the accuracy and consistency of data over its entire lifecycle. It is often summarized using the acronym ALCOA, which stands for Attributable, Legible, Contemporaneous, Original, and Accurate. The FDA emphasizes the need for adherence to these principles, especially in electronic records as stipulated in 21 CFR Part 11. Recent enforcement actions data integrity reveal failures common in many organizations, mainly due to:

  • ALCOA Plus Failures: Additional principles such as Complete, Consistent, Enduring, and Available (ALCOA Plus) have been recognized as essential.
  • Audit Trail Issues: Failure to maintain proper audit trails can lead to a lack of accountability in data recording and manipulations.
  • Access Control Gaps: Unauthorized access to critical data can compromise its integrity.

Collecting and Analyzing 483 Data

The collection of FDA 483 data requires a structured approach, starting with identifying all queries and responses provided to the FDA during inspections. This can be achieved by accessing resources such as the official FDA website, where forms and historical data are archived.

Once data is collected, a systematic analysis needs to be conducted. Data should be categorized based on the type of observation, potential root causes, and frequency. Employing statistical methods can yield insights into the likelihood of recurrence and help benchmark against industry standards.

Steps for analyzing 483 trend data include:

  1. Data Collection: Access FDA databases, specifically noting the relevant Form FDA 483 data that correlates with data integrity.
  2. Categorization: Sort observations into categories; for instance, failures specific to data handling, electronic records, or audit trails.
  3. Trend Analysis: Utilize software tools to visualize trends over time. This could include graphs or heat maps highlighting persistent issues.

This analytical phase is instrumental in recognizing both the breadth and depth of data integrity issues within your organization. Once trends are established, the next focus must be on how to present this data effectively on an executive dashboard.

Designing Executive Dashboards to Monitor Data Integrity

With an understanding of 483 trends established, designing an executive dashboard becomes imperative for ongoing monitoring and prevention. Executives require a comprehensive yet streamlined view that can quickly convey the health of the data integrity landscape within the organization.

Key elements to consider when designing the dashboard include:

  • Visualization of Trends: Use graphical representations (e.g., line charts for trends over time, pie charts for proportion of different data integrity issues) to depict data clearly.
  • KPIs and Metrics: Define Key Performance Indicators (KPIs) relevant to data integrity. Metrics may include the number of observations per year, resolution times, and audit trail discrepancies.
  • Alert Systems: Implement real-time alerts for any new observations or compliance breaches. This can facilitate immediate corrective actions.

Setting Remediation Expectations

Establishing clear remediation expectations is vital once data integrity failures are identified through the dashboard. Organizations must adopt a proactive approach toward addressing the root causes of these failures. The remediation process should outline specific actions that will be taken in response to the data integrity issues highlighted in the 483 trends.

Key components of remediation expectations are as follows:

  • Root Cause Analysis: Conduct detailed investigations into the underlying factors contributing to data integrity failures.
  • Action Plans: Develop actionable steps to rectify identified issues, complete with timelines and responsible parties assigned.
  • Communication: Ensure that all stakeholders and affected departments are informed and involved in the remediation process.

Furthermore, incorporating lessons learned from previous enforcement actions data integrity leads to a culture of continuous improvement. Establishing regular training programs around data integrity principles and compliance will foster a knowledgeable workforce prepared to uphold regulatory standards.

Comparing Global Guidance on Data Integrity and Executive Dashboards

While this tutorial primarily provides guidance in the context of US regulations, it is crucial to recognize the similarities and differences in global guidelines regarding data integrity. The European Medicines Agency (EMA) and the UK’s Medicines and Healthcare products Regulatory Agency (MHRA) offer guidance that aligns closely with the FDA’s focus on data integrity.

For instance, EMA’s directive emphasizes ALCOA principles and stresses the importance of data traceability and access controls similar to FDA expectations. The MHRA has also highlighted the necessity for organizations to perform regular audits and maintain transparency through effective documentation practices.

In incorporating these international perspectives into your executive dashboards, consider adding comparative metrics to your KPIs, enabling organizations to benchmark not only against past performance but also against industry standards across regions.
